Spring weather in Ohio can be unpredictable, and that's okay. Ohio's privately owned campgrounds are experienced at keeping campers safe when the skies get serious.
A few good things to know before your next trip:
βΊ Shelter β Most campgrounds have a designated storm shelter, often the bathhouse or a permanent structure. When you check in, ask your campground host where to go if weather rolls in.
π‘ Utilities β Campgrounds may temporarily shut off electricity and water as a precaution during severe weather. It's routine and it passes. Pack a battery-powered lantern and a gallon or two of drinking water just in case.
π Pack a little extra β A small weather kit goes a long way: flashlight, phone charger bank, bottled water, and any medications you may need.
The best campers are prepared campers, and Ohio's campground owners are right there with you every step of the way.
